W/Cup Qualifiers: Nigeria Volleyball Federation name squad, departs for Abidjan tomorrow

Dare Kuti
Last updated: August 16, 2017 3:11 pm
Dare Kuti
Published: August 16, 2017
Share
As featured on NewsNow: Sport news
Sport News 24/7 

The Nigerian women volleyball team is expected to leave the shores of Nigeria tomorrow (Thursday) for Abidjan, Cote D’ivore, to participate at the women World Cup tournament.

The tournament will hold between August 18 and 22 in Abidjan.

The 14 female players were selected after two weeks training in Abuja.

A statement signed by the Secretary General NVBF, Adamu Maikano, listed the names of players to represent Nigeria at the tournament as Ladi Jalmat, Theresa Okonma Helen Umeh, Aisha Umar, Chinese Nwosu, Esther Dusu, Albertina Francis.

Others are Kelechi Iwobi, Agera Precilla, Comfort Amdu, Francisca Ikhiede, Chimdia  Ive, Mary John and Chinedu  Nnachi.

The team will be led by Head coach Usman Abdallah and Gloria Peter Ret.
